Mo Salah ’emerges as Barcelona’s Top Alternative to Erling Haaland this summer’
Barcelona has identified Liverpool star Mohamed Salah as a possible replacement for Borussia Dortmund wonderkid Erling Haaland.
The Egypt international’s contract expires in 2023 and, despite the Reds’ best efforts, the club and player have failed to agree on a new deal.
Haaland remains the Catalan giants’ top objective, but they have compiled a shortlist of alternates in case that deal falls through. According to reports, if a deal for Manchester City target Haaland falls through, Salah, along with Bayern Munich attacker Robert Lewandowski and Chelsea target Romelu Lukaku, will be the next in line.
Lewandowski’s contract, like Salah’s, expires in 2023, while Lukaku joined the Blues in a £97million deal last summer. But his future remains uncertain following a disappointing year.
Chelsea’s future is similarly uncertain, with owner Roman Abramovich facing sanctions and new owners certain to arrive ahead of the summer transfer window, with preferred bids now being shortlisted.
While the emphasis remains on Haaland, Barcelona face stiff competition from Pep Guardiola’s City, who are willing to splurge the cash on the Norwegian – meaning Salah, Lewandowski, or Lukaku might end up being first-choice options.
Although Salah is not a centre-forward, Barcelona manager Xavi is reportedly hell-bent on utilizing the Liverpool star as his Nou Camp No 9.
At Liverpool, Salah is thought to be seeking £400,000 per week, which would make him comfortably the club’s highest-paid player.
Jurgen Klopp, Liverpool’s manager, has already claimed that he is unconcerned with Salah’s contract dispute.
